1. Start with the site and its actual dependencies
South Strabane township is recorded in Washington County, Pennsylvania, with a 2020–2024 ACS five-year population estimate of 9,647 and a margin of error of 19. That is geographic context, not evidence of website demand, search volume or case volume. For hosting, its practical value is narrower: it helps define the service area named in the firm’s website and gives the firm a reason to inventory the pages, forms and contact paths intended to serve that area. Before discussing infrastructure, identify the website platform, databases, forms, media, redirects, DNS records, SSL arrangements, analytics access and any external services the site relies on. The hosting decision should be based on those dependencies rather than on population alone.
